计算机毕业设计springboot针对外国学生及服务国立大学的中介平台 配套有源码 程序 mysql数据库 论文本套源码可以在文本联xi,先看具体系统功能演示视频领取可分享源码参考。随着全球化的深入发展越来越多的外国学生选择赴蒙古国留学以获取独特的文化体验和高质量的教育资源。然而由于语言和文化差异以及信息不对称外国学生在申请蒙古国高校时常常面临诸多困难院校信息分散、招生政策不透明、奖学金申请流程复杂、缺乏有效的沟通交流渠道。现有的留学服务模式多为线下咨询或单一院校官网查询无法满足学生一站式获取多所高校信息、对比招生条件、在线交流互动的需求。为了提高留学申请效率、提供全面而准确的信息服务同时促进蒙古高等教育的国际化构建一个集成院校展示、招生管理、奖学金服务、交流互动于一体的综合性中介平台显得尤为重要。通过先进的信息技术手段如网站构建和数据库管理实现对蒙古国各高校信息的集成展示和高效管理能够有效降低留学门槛提升教育交流的质量与效率。本文档详细阐述了一套基于Java技术和SpringBoot框架开发的留学中介服务平台的设计与实现方案。系统采用MySQL数据库进行数据存储结合Vue前端技术实现了前后端分离的架构设计将用户分为管理员、管理者和普通用户三大角色满足不同层面的业务需求。系统核心功能涵盖以下模块我的信息为用户提供个人信息查看与维护功能支持基础资料的修改更新。管理者管理对平台运营管理者进行管理包括账号配置、权限分配等操作。用户管理对注册用户进行管理维护用户账号、头像、姓名、性别、手机号码等基础信息。院校信息管理集中展示蒙古国各高校详细信息包括院校名称、类型、地址、规模、创立时间、负责人、联系方式、院校介绍、院校图片等支持信息检索与收藏。招生类型管理维护不同的招生类别为招生信息发布提供分类支撑。招生信息管理发布各院校招生详情包括院校名称、类型、招生类型、招生年份、招生人数、招生日期、报名材料、报名时间、报名详情等支持点赞、评论、收藏等互动功能。奖学金类型管理维护奖学金分类体系为奖学金信息发布提供类型支撑。奖学金信息管理发布奖学金详细信息包括名称、类型、奖项类别、金额、封面、发布时间、所需材料、详细内容等支持按条件检索与互动操作。交流论坛提供用户交流互动空间支持帖子发布、内容管理、状态设置、置顶操作等促进留学生之间的经验分享与问题讨论。系统管理包含校园资讯发布与分类管理、关于我们信息维护、系统简介配置、轮播图管理等基础支撑功能为平台运营提供内容管理支持。这套系统通过多角色权限设计将平台管理、院校运营、学生服务有机整合形成了完整的留学服务生态链。各模块之间数据互通院校信息、招生信息、奖学金信息相互关联交流论坛为用户提供互动空间既满足了外国学生获取留学信息的核心需求又为蒙古国高校提供了展示窗口和招生渠道同时通过管理者角色实现了院校自主运营。系统的实施能够有效解决传统留学申请中存在的信息分散、沟通不畅、流程繁琐等问题为提升教育国际化水平、促进跨文化交流提供有力的技术支撑。注:以上是纯课题毕业设计功能介绍并非实际开发完成最终开发完成的毕业设计程序以下面的的环境软件、功能图和界面为准。系统所需要的环境软件idea、eclipsemysql5.7、8.0NavicatJDK1.8tomcat7.03.3系统用例分析本系统分为管理员、管理者和用户三大模块管理员的权利是最大的可以对系统所有功能进行管理其次是管理者和用户用例分别如下所示图3-1 管理员用例图图3-2 管理者用例图图3-3 用户用例图3.4系统流程分析本系统登录流程图如图3-4所示。图3-4登录流程图本系统添加信息流程图如图3-5所示。图3-5 添加信息流程图第四章 系统设计4.1系统功能及工作原理设计设计这个管理系统能使用户实现不需出门就可以在电脑前进行个人信息修改对系统功能进行有效管理。本系统由管理员、管理者和用户三大模块组成。通过数据交互与数据传输实现本系统的所有功能。管理员登录进入系统直接管理我的信息、管理者管理、用户管理、院校信息管理、招生类型管理、招生信息管理、奖学金类型管理、奖学金信息管理、交流论坛、系统管理等信息。本网站模块设计的独立性强用户体验良好、后期维护修改管理十分方便。管理者模块的主要设计是在登陆成功后本系统实现对我的信息、招生类型管理、招生信息管理、奖学金类型管理、奖学金信息管理等功能进行详细操作用户模块的主要设计是在登陆成功后本系统实现对院校信息、招生信息、奖学金信息、交流论坛、校友资讯、个人中心等功能进行详细操作本系统是以网络业务模式为基础的适合于互联网的应用。只要能连接到互联网就可以不受到时间和地点的限制随便来使用本针对外国留学生的蒙古国各高校介绍系统系统。针对外国留学生的蒙古国各高校介绍系统系统工作原理图如图4-1所示。图4-1 系统工作原理图4.2程序结构图本系统登录结构图如图4-2所示。图4-2 登录结构图系统分成三个角色根据每个角色的权限分析得出三大模块包括管理员模块管理者模块、用户模块管理员模块主要针对整个系统的管理进行设计提高了管理的效率和标准。系统的总体模块功能设计如下图所示:图4-3 系统总体功能结构图4.3数据库的设计所有的网站设计都离不开数据库数据库是所有项目实现如数据采集、数据传输等功能的基石。只有合理的数据库设计才能满足商业化的要求主键外键数据库的连接方式尤为重要尽量避免多对多的复杂性字段命名合理标准且易于理解字段应根据业务设置不允许操作字段而对系统有额外的占用内存。4.3.1数据库实体及属性本针对外国留学生的蒙古国各高校介绍系统的E-R图描述了在系统中各个实体之间的联系以下将对“校园资讯、管理者、交流论坛”等作为实体它们的局部E-R图如图4-4所示图4-4局部E-R图5.1.1系统首页页面当人们打开系统的网址后首先看到的就是首页界面。在这里人们能够看到系统的导航条通过导航条导航进入各功能展示页面进行操作。系统首页界面如图5-1所示图5-1 系统首页界面院校信息在院校信息页面的输入栏中输入院校名称、院校类型和院校地址进行查询可以查看到院校详细信息并进行收藏操作院校信息页面如图5-2所示图5-3院校信息详细页面校园资讯在校园资讯页面通过输入标题进行搜索还可以对校园资讯进行点赞或收藏操作校园资讯页面如图5-3所示图5-3校园资讯详细页面5.1.2个人中心个人中心在个人中心页面可以对修改密码、我的发布、我的收藏进行详细操作如图5-4所示图5-4个人中心界面5.2后台模块实现在登录流程中用户首先在Vue前端界面输入用户名和密码。这些信息通过HTTP请求发送到Java后端。后端接收请求通过与MySQL数据库交互验证用户凭证。如果认证成功后端返回给前端允许用户访问系统。这个过程涵盖了从用户输入到系统验证和响应的全过程。后台登录界面图5-5所示。图5-5 后台登录界面5.2.1管理员功能实现管理员进入主页面主要功能包括对我的信息、管理者管理、用户管理、院校信息管理、招生类型管理、招生信息管理、奖学金类型管理、奖学金信息管理、交流论坛、系统管理等进行操作。管理员主页面如图5-6所示图5-6管理员主界面管理者功能在视图层view层进行交互比如点击“查询、新增或删除”按钮或填写管理者表单。这些管理者表单动作被视图层捕获并作为请求发送给相应的控制器层controller层。控制器接收到这些请求后调用服务层service层以执行相关的业务逻辑例如验证输入数据的有效性和与数据库的交互。服务层处理完这些逻辑后进一步与数据访问对象层DAO层交互后者负责具体的数据操作如详情、编辑或移除管理者信息并将操作结果返回给控制器。最终控制器根据这些结果更新视图层以便管理者功能可以看到最新的信息或相应的操作反馈。管理者界面如图5-7所示图5-7管理者管理界面用户功能在视图层view层进行交互比如点击“搜索、新增或删除”按钮或填写用户表单。这些用户表单动作被视图层捕获并作为请求发送给相应的控制器层controller层。控制器接收到这些请求后调用服务层service层以执行相关的业务逻辑例如验证输入数据的有效性和与数据库的交互。服务层处理完这些逻辑后进一步与数据访问对象层DAO层交互后者负责具体的数据操作如详情、编辑或移除用户信息并将操作结果返回给控制器。最终控制器根据这些结果更新视图层以便用户功能可以看到最新的信息或相应的操作反馈。用户界面如图5-8所示图5-8用户管理界面院校信息功能在视图层view层进行交互比如点击“搜索、新增或删除”按钮或填写院校信息表单。这些院校信息表单动作被视图层捕获并作为请求发送给相应的控制器层controller层。控制器接收到这些请求后调用服务层service层以执行相关的业务逻辑例如验证输入数据的有效性和与数据库的交互。服务层处理完这些逻辑后进一步与数据访问对象层DAO层交互后者负责具体的数据操作如详情、编辑或移除院校信息并将操作结果返回给控制器。最终控制器根据这些结果更新视图层以便院校信息功能可以看到最新的信息或相应的操作反馈。院校信息界面如图5-9所示图5-9院校信息管理界面招生类型功能在视图层view层进行交互比如点击“搜索、新增或删除”按钮或填写招生类型表单。这些招生类型表单动作被视图层捕获并作为请求发送给相应的控制器层controller层。控制器接收到这些请求后调用服务层service层以执行相关的业务逻辑例如验证输入数据的有效性和与数据库的交互。服务层处理完这些逻辑后进一步与数据访问对象层DAO层交互后者负责具体的数据操作如详情、编辑或移除招生类型信息并将操作结果返回给控制器。最终控制器根据这些结果更新视图层以便招生类型功能可以看到最新的信息或相应的操作反馈。招生类型界面如图5-10所示图5-10招生类型管理界面5.2.2管理者功能实现管理者进入主页面主要功能包括对我的信息、招生类型管理、招生信息管理、奖学金类型管理、奖学金信息管理等进行操作。管理者主页面如图5-11所示图5-11管理者主界面源码无偿分享文未领取